The Demon Lord Is An Angel

Chapter 45: Daisy The Destroyer



For the second time, Kir found himself in the stadium.

After going through the formalities, they moved on to the stakes. Daisy bet that Kir would have to obey her as long as he was in the Academy and Kir bet that Daisy would have to apologize, leave him alone, and pay him five gold. The last he added on a whim, figuring that perhaps charging a semester's worth of survival money would deter future aggression.

Even so, the construct in charge of the arena weighted his demands as less than hers.

Before the fight, he and Rain had a talk.

"Listen, I'm sorry I got you into this mess. If you want to forfeit I'll do everything in my power to make sure she drops it before it becomes official," Rainier said, his eyes so full of sincere regret Kir couldn't help but melt a little inside. "She's been after me for the last year, not you."

"I'm not going to back down from a fight," Kir said. "People keep wanting to see what I'm made of, why I'm here, and the only way I get out of this is to go through anyone in my way. Besides, you shouldn't have to put up with her."

"But she's a noble... I can't just..." Rainier seemed taken aback, but he quickly recovered. "Look, if you're really going to fight her, Daisy's not exactly known for fighting fair... there's a reason they call her The Destroyer."

"I've been in unfair fights since the day I was born. What else is new?" Kir smirked.

"Have you ever faced a void sorceress?" Rain asked.

"No, what's that?" Kir asked.

"Well..."
